What to check before you start
Agree on how long the first session lasts. A common fail is “one hour” turning into a marathon with no warning. Name the online window honestly.
Safety and boundaries
Do not share passwords, recovery codes, or personal data. For a first session, a game contact and a time agreement are enough. If someone pressures you, rushes you, or sends shady links — stop talking.
